Why did parliament raise taxes on the colonies after the French and Indian war

Respuesta :

victorialittle06 victorialittle06
  • 14-04-2020

Answer: The king and parliament believed they had the right to tax the colonies. they decided to require several kinds of taxes from the colonists to help pay for the french and indian war.
